What is the final step in the recruitment process described?

Explanation:
Giving feedback to unsuccessful applicants is the final step. After you’ve advertised the job, interviewed candidates, and evaluated and shortlisted applicants, the process closes by informing those not offered the position and explaining how they performed or why they weren’t selected. This helps maintain a positive employer image, supports candidates’ learning for future opportunities, and reduces potential misunderstandings or complaints. The earlier steps—advertising, interviewing, and shortlisting—all happen before this wrap-up stage, so they aren’t the final action in the process.
